Comboios Portugal (CP) is the main train company in Portugal operating medium and long-distance train services operating across Portugal. CP train types include International (IN) which connect Portugal with Spain and France; Alfa Pendular (AP) operating high-speed trains up to 220 km/h between Porto, Lisbon and Faro; Intercidades, long-distance trains operating up to 200km/h; Inter-Regional (IR), which offer medium distance services; and Regional, CP's local services. There are two types of fares available for CP trains: Promo (booked 5-60 days in advance and non-refundable) and Normal (refundable for a fee) available for both 1st and 2nd class tickets. Looking for a convenient way to travel from Faro to Portugal’s vibrant capital city? The train from Faro Airport (FAO) to Lisbon is a comfortable and scenic option. While there is no direct train departing from Faro Airport, frequent services are available from Faro Train Station, the nearest major railway station to the airport. From there, trains connect to Lisbon's Oriente Station, offering a smooth journey between the Algarve region and Lisbon. Traveling by train from Faro Airport (FAO) to Lisbon is a comfortable and scenic choice for exploring Portugal. Comboios de Portugal, the primary rail service provider in the country, offers Intercity (Intercidades) and Alfa Pendular trains on this route. The Intercidades trains are known for their affordability and essential amenities, while the Alfa Pendular trains provide a faster, premium experience with spacious seating, onboard Wi-Fi, and a café service.
